Public relations and search engine optimization are two forces that have more in common than most marketers realize. Both disciplines aim to build trust, authority, and visibility, just through different marketing channels. When combined, they form a winning combination that helps your company earn credibility, improve search engine rankings, and drive traffic that converts.
A modern SEO PR strategy aligns storytelling with search visibility. PR campaigns are no longer measured only by impressions or press hits; they’re key to improving SEO performance. PR teams and SEO teams now share the same business goals: boost awareness, drive organic traffic, and convert potential customers through multiple customer journey touchpoints.
Media coverage builds backlinks and brand reputation. Those quality backlinks raise your search engine rankings, which attract more coverage, a self-sustaining loop that compounds authority over time. In the digital world, Google’s algorithms reward credible sources, and a well-executed PR strategy reinforces exactly that.
Digital PR strengthens your online reputation by creating consistent, verifiable signals across relevant publications and social media channels. Those mentions enhance Google’s understanding of your brand entity. When your PR strategy produces high-quality content that journalists and audiences engage with, it fuels both E-E-A-T and AI visibility.
Earned media SEO is at the heart of any good SEO strategy. It’s not about chasing more links; it’s about earning the right ones. Public relations and search engine optimization work hand in hand to create content that builds authority while aligning with search intent.
| PR Asset | SEO Signal | Internal Link Target | Optimization Notes |
| Press release | Backlink & citation | Product/service page | Add canonical tag + schema |
| Media coverage | Implied link | About or leadership page | Maintain consistent bios |
| Guest posts | Contextual backlink | Blog cluster | Ensure keyword alignment |
| Data campaigns | Link earning | Resource hub | Add visuals and statistics |
| Awards/industry recognition | Trust signal | Homepage | Use Organization schema |

To measure success, track both search engine and media metrics. Start by evaluating coverage quality: how authoritative, relevant, and well-indexed your media placements are across the web. Next, monitor link metrics such as the number of quality backlinks, anchor text diversity, and link inserts that reinforce your SEO campaigns. Assess organic performance through search rankings, organic traffic growth, and branded search volume to gauge how effectively earned media drives visibility. Revenue indicators also matter: determine how referral traffic and conversions connect to specific PR and SEO efforts. Finally, measure AI visibility by identifying where your brand appears within AI-generated search results.
Using Google Analytics and SEO tools ensures that your PR strategies align with long-term SEO performance and business goals, providing measurable insight into the success of your digital marketing initiatives.

What’s the difference between digital PR and link building?
Digital PR builds awareness and credibility through storytelling, while link building focuses on backlinks. Together, they form the foundation of a strong SEO campaign.
How long until earned media impacts search engine rankings?
It depends on indexing and authority, but most SEO results appear within 2–3 months.
Can PR improve online reputation management?
Yes. Consistent, positive coverage across multiple marketing channels helps shape public perception and search visibility.
Does PR help with local SEO?
Definitely. Regional features, community initiatives, and geo-tagged mentions enhance local search rankings and visibility.
Can media coverage influence AI search results?
Yes, search engines and AI models favor diverse, authoritative coverage when curating answers.
